Hi,

 

I use custom headers on all my pages, and if I use the method described here to change the forum page, it fails to use my header on the page. In Elementor my custom page is /forums/ and it has my header. When I set that setting to /forums, it overwrites my custom forum page. My other option, which works fine, is to use the shortcode

[wpforo]

Like i said, this works on my /forums/ page. However, it is going to throw the SEO all off when it uses the site-map.xml settings from the /whatever-slug-i-put-in-the-settings-page.

 

What would be the best way to correct this so I can have my custom page header, wpforo, and a proper sitemap?

Hi @todesengel,

First you should create a new page with your Elementor. Then put wpForo shortciode in that page. Then go to Forums > Settings > General Tab and change the forum base URL to the new Elementor page slug (URL path), so it'll call your customized page.

Don't forget to delete other forum pages if you have. Only keep one forum page, that one should have the same slug (URL path) as you've set it for forum Base URL.
